    Honours+ is the Common Core for all faculty honours programmes.  In Honours+, 2nd-year bachelor students (1st year honours students) are challenged to work on an academic and interesting assignment (the so-called challenge) in groups of 4-6 students from different faculties.

    Honours+ is organized by EDLAB, the Maastricht University Centre for Teaching & Learning.
    Besides working on their interdisciplinary challenge, the students will partake in a series of workshops to work on their academic and professional skills.

  • H+ Supervisor Training Programme

    Every year, Honours+ organizes a special training programme for Supervisors (together with other staff working with the EDLAB honours students), aimed at providing everyone with the knowledge and tools required for supporting our students the best way possible.

    We would like to point out that we highly appreciate everyone’s attendance at these events since it assures a high level of supervision during the Honours+ programme. Next to that, these events also bring Supervisors together to share thoughts and experiences.

    We will award an official Honours+ certificate, signed by UM’s rector to all H+ Supervisors that have attended at least 3 trainings. Besides that, these trainings may count towards a Supervisor’s CPD, depending on their personal development goals, in discussion with their supervisor or manager.
